Fuel Cell Vehicles to be Tax-Exempt

Keywords: Eco-business / Social Venture Environmental Technology Government Policy / Systems Transportation / Mobility 

On August 21, Japan's Ministry of Land, Infrastructure and Transport (MLIT) decided on a policy which would call for a two-year exemption of automobile acquisition tax and auto tax imposed on fuel cell vehicles that auto manufacturers aim to release by the end of 2002.

Toyota Motor Corp. and Honda Motor Co. are planning to begin the sales of fuel cell vehicles within the year, and MLIT aims to promote popularization of fuel cell vehicles by the tax reduction and exemption.
